Summary

Eastern Europe has become an ideological battleground since the collapse of the Soviet Union, with liberals and authoritarians struggling to seize the ground lost by Marxism. This book traces the intellectual history of this struggle and warns that authoritarian nationalists pose a serious threat to democratic forces.

"Vladimir Tismanueanu is a prominent essayist and an expert on contemporary policyHe knows everything about Central and Eastern Europe. . .I warmly recommend this book—it is as controversial as it is inspiring."—Adam Michnik, author of Letters from Prison, editor of Wyborcza (Warsaw)
Vladimir Tismaneanu is Professor of Government and Politics, University of Maryland at College Park. He is the author of "Reinventing Politics: Eastern Europe from Stalin to Havel" (Free Press).
